Saying the package will provide the nations economy with, quote, "a booster shot," President Bush signed a 152-billion-dollar economic stimulus bill into law today.
Tax rebates are expected to be in the mail to Americans in a few months.
Under the plan, individual taxpayers would receive 600-dollar rebates, while married couples would get 12-hundred-dollars.
Parents would receive 300-dollars per child, and disabled veterans and retired people would get 300-dollars each.
Bush thanked Congress as well as its Democratic leadership for passing the bill quickly without loading it up with pork.
